EVANSVILLE, Ind. – In its second event of the fall, the University of Evansville women's tennis team went undefeated in competition against USI, Austin Peay and the University of Charleston on Friday at Wesselman Park as part of the UE/USI Fall Invitational.
As a team, the Purple Aces played two doubles matches and one round of singles. Evansville faced Charleston in its singles action, going a perfect 7-0. Flight one saw
Natasha James deal the loss to Toni Katipa, 6-0, 6-1.
Marketa Trousilova kept it rolling in the second flight, defeating Kelsey Hensley, 6-1, 6-1.
In the third flight,
Andjela Brguljan topped Ana Pena, 6-1, 6-1 while
Marina Moreno beat Marieve Edwards in the fourth flight, 6-3, 6-2. Flight five saw
Kennedy Craig defeat Jackie Bakos, 6-2, 6-3 while
Gaby Fifer earned the win over Taylor Todd in the sixth flight, 6-2, 6-3.
Mina Milovic played in the seventh flight, defeating Courtney Pierron, 6-2, 6-0.
Doubles play saw Evansville face Austin Peay and USI. At the top flight, Trousilova and Moreno defeated Ornella DiSalvo/Vanessa Tavares of Austin Peay by an 8-1 final while topping Elizabeth Wilm and Ashlee Hasson of USI, 8-0.
Flight two featured James and Brguljan, who beat Hannah Tatlock/Brittney Covington of APSU, 8-3 while earning an 8-4 victory over Kelsey Shipman/Brenna Wu of the Screaming Eagles. Craig and Milovic kept the perfect day rolling in flight three doubles. They topped Jovana Karac of Austin Peay and Taylor Youell of Charleston by an 8-0 final. APSU had just five doubles participants as Youell took the sixth spot. Against USI, Craig and Milovic earned an 8-4 win over Elizabeth Skinner and Miranda Camp.
Play resumes on Saturday morning beginning at 9 a.m. at Wesselman Park.
